Soup Too Heavy
Your soup feels heavy and rich because there is too much cream or fat. Lighten it with stock and acid.

Why it happened
Too much fat coats the palate and dulls flavor. Dilution and acid restore balance without removing all richness.
The fix
- 1 whisk in 1/2 cup warm stock to lighten
- 2 add 1 teaspoon lemon juice to brighten
- 3 finish with herbs and black pepper
If it's still wrong
- serve smaller portions with a crisp salad
- add a crunchy topping for contrast
Prevent next time
- add cream at the end in small amounts
- balance rich soups with acid or herbs

Why this works
A small amount of stock thins the soup without washing out flavor. Acid and herbs cut the richness so the soup feels lighter on the palate.
Substitutions
- lemon juice → vinegar
- herbs → scallions
